Understanding Online Betting
Online betting refers to wagering on various games or events through the internet. This can contain casino games, sports betting, poker, and more. The rise of technology has made it more comfortable than ever for individuals to access online gambling platforms, but with this accessibility comes a range of risks.
Financial Risks
Loss of Money
The most apparent risk associated with online betting is the potential for financial loss. Unlike traditional casinos, where players can physically see their money, online platforms often make it easier to lose track of spending. Players may find themselves betting more than they can afford, leading to significant financial strain.
Hidden Fees
Many online betting platforms, including those in the Philippines, may have hidden fees that are not immediately apparent. These can include transaction fees, withdrawal fees, and currency conversion charges. Players must read the fine print before engaging in online betting to avoid unexpected costs.
Fraud and Scams

Addiction and Mental Health Risks
Gambling Addiction
One of the most potent risks of online betting is the possibility of developing a gambling addiction. The convenience of accessing gambling sites from home can lead to excessive play, which can spiral into addiction. Signs of gambling addiction include:
- Increasing the amount of time spent gambling.
- Chasing losses and betting more to recover lost funds.
- Neglecting personal and professional responsibilities.
Mental Health Issues
Gambling addiction can lead to different mental health issues, including anxiety, depression, and stress. The pressure to win can create an unhealthy cycle of emotional highs and lows, impacting overall well-being. Punters should be mindful of their gambling habits and seek help if they notice signs of addiction.
Legal Risks
Regulatory Compliance
In the Philippines, online gambling is regulated by the Philippine Amusement and Gaming Corporation (PAGCOR). However, not all online betting sites operate legally, and players risk legal consequences if they engage with unlicensed operators. Age Restrictions
Most jurisdictions, including the Philippines, have strict age restrictions for gambling. Engaging in online betting underage can lead to legal repercussions for both the player and the operator. Players must confirm they meet the legal age requirements before participating in online gambling.
Security Risks
Data Privacy
Online betting concerns sharing personal and financial information, which can pose a danger if the platform does not have robust security measures. Cybersecurity threats, such as hacking and data breaches, can compromise player information. Choosing platforms that employ encryption and other security protocols to protect user data is essential.
Payment Security
Making deposits and withdrawals online comes with its own set of risks. Gamblers must ensure that the payment methods used are secure and that the platform has a good reputation for processing transactions. Using unsecured payment methods can lead to fraud and identity theft.
Social Risks
Isolation
Extreme online betting can lead to social isolation. Players may spend more time gambling than engaging in social activities, which can strain relationships with family and friends. It is crucial to maintain a balance between online betting and social interactions.
Stigmatization
Gambling, especially online, can carry a stigma in some cultures, including the Philippines. Players may face judgment or ostracism from family and friends if their gambling habits become known. This social risk can exacerbate feelings of shame and lead to further isolation.
Responsible Gambling Practices
Players should adopt responsible gambling practices to mitigate the risks associated with free online betting. Here are some strategies to consider:
Set Limits
Establishing a budget for gambling activities can help prevent excessive spending. Players should set limits on how much they are ready to wager and stick to those limits.
Take Breaks
Taking regular breaks from gambling can help maintain a healthy balance. Players should avoid continuous play and ensure they engage in other activities outside of online betting.
Seek Help
If gambling becomes a problem, punters should seek help from professional organizations or support groups. Many resources are available in the Philippines for individuals struggling with gambling addiction.
